设计驱动与创新,大数据时代的设计变革
1 2025-01-26
在当今这个数字时代,网页设计已成为企业展示自身形象、传递信息的重要手段。而CSS(层叠样式表)作为网页设计中不可或缺的一部分,其设计思路图的合理性直接影响到网页的整体效果。本文将深入解析CSS设计思路图,探讨其核心原则,以期为读者提供有益的启示。
一、CSS设计思路图概述
CSS设计思路图是指用图形化的方式展示CSS在设计网页过程中所遵循的规则和原则。它将CSS的基本概念、属性、选择器等以直观、易懂的方式呈现出来,有助于设计师更好地理解和使用CSS。
二、CSS设计思路图的核心原则
1. 结构化思维
结构化思维是CSS设计思路图的基础。它要求设计师在构建网页时,首先明确网页的整体结构,然后根据需求划分模块,最后将各个模块进行组合。这种思维方式有助于提高网页的可维护性和扩展性。
2. 约束性原则
CSS设计思路图强调约束性原则,即在设计过程中,要遵循一定的规范和标准。例如,CSS属性值的取值范围、选择器的优先级等。遵循约束性原则,可以使网页设计更加规范、统一。
3. 优先级原则
在CSS设计思路图中,优先级原则体现在两个方面:一是选择器的优先级,二是属性值的优先级。选择器优先级决定了CSS规则对元素的生效顺序,属性值优先级则决定了当多个属性值冲突时,哪一个值将被采纳。遵循优先级原则,可以确保网页效果的一致性。
4. 响应式设计
随着移动设备的普及,响应式设计已成为CSS设计思路图的重要原则。响应式设计要求网页在不同设备和屏幕尺寸下都能保持良好的视觉效果。在设计过程中,要充分考虑设备差异,运用媒体查询等技巧实现响应式布局。
5. 语义化标签
CSS设计思路图提倡使用语义化标签,如HTML5中的
6. 优化性能
在CSS设计思路图中,性能优化是一个重要环节。优化性能包括减少HTTP请求、压缩CSS文件、合理使用CSS选择器等。通过优化性能,可以提高网页的加载速度,提升用户体验。
三、CSS设计思路图的实际应用
1. 预处理器的应用
CSS预处理器的出现,使得CSS设计思路图在实际应用中更加灵活。如Sass、Less等预处理工具,可以将CSS代码转换为更加高效的CSS文件,提高开发效率。
2. 模块化设计
模块化设计是CSS设计思路图在实践中的体现。将网页划分为多个模块,每个模块负责特定的功能,便于管理和维护。
3. CSS框架的使用
CSS框架如Bootstrap、Foundation等,遵循CSS设计思路图的原则,提供了一套完善的组件和样式,帮助设计师快速搭建网页。
总结
CSS设计思路图是现代网页设计的核心原则之一,其合理布局的关键词有助于设计师更好地理解和使用CSS。在实际应用中,遵循CSS设计思路图的原则,可以提高网页的视觉效果、性能和用户体验。